Gas lasers are a type of laser that uses a gas mixture as the laser medium to produce coherent light. The gas mixture is typically excited by an electrical discharge or other means to generate the laser beam. Gas lasers are used in various applications such as cutting, marking, welding, and scientific research.

The lasing material in a helium-neon laser is a mixture of helium and neon gases. The neon gas is responsible for emitting the red laser light when excited by the helium gas.
